What temperature does a capacitor work?

Generally, most capacitors work well between -30oC to +125oC. Nominal voltage ratings for a working temperature for plastic capacitor types are no more than +70oC. Electrolytic capacitors and aluminium electrolytic capacitors are susceptible to deformation at high temperatures because of leaking and internal pressure.

What is the working voltage of a capacitor?

The Working Voltage is another important capacitor characteristic that defines the maximum continuous voltage either DC or AC that can be applied to the capacitor without failure during its working life. Generally, the working voltage printed onto the side of a capacitors body refers to its DC working voltage, (WVDC).
